Teen, driver dead as car falls into lift shaft

Last Updated 21 April 2016, 19:23 IST

A 14-year-old boy and his family driver were killed when the car they were sitting in fell down the car elevator shaft here on Wednesday evening.

The car plunged two stories down the car elevator shaft of 22-storeyed Iqbal Heights in the Agripada area of south Mumbai. The teenager Hafiz Patel and Javed Iqbal (26) died in the accident.

The Mumbai Police, which is investigating the matter, is looking at multiple CCTV footages, to ascertain what exactly happened.

Patel lived in Iqbal Heights with his parents and two sisters in the building which is near Maratha Mandir cinema hall.

Initial investigations revealed that it was Patel who was at the wheels. He was approaching the door of the second floor car lift shaft in reverse when it appears to have pressed the accelerator and banged on the shaft.

 “The lift door opened due to the force of the impact, and the car fell into the elevator duct,” said a police officer, adding that the two victims were stuck inside the car, a Toyota Etios, for a very long time.
